2025 Toyota Land Cruiser Pricing Overview

The base model of the 2025 Land Cruiser starts at approximately $85,000, with higher trims and additional features pushing the price beyond $100,000. Key factors influencing the cost include engine options, interior upgrades, and advanced driver-assistance systems. Buyers should also consider destination charges, taxes, and dealership fees, which can add several thousand dollars to the final price.

Trim Levels and Their Costs

  • Base Model: Starts at $85,000, offering standard features like a V6 engine, leather seats, and a 12.3-inch infotainment system.
  • Mid-Level Trim: Priced around $95,000, adding premium audio, advanced safety tech, and off-road enhancements.
  • Top-Tier Trim: Exceeds $100,000 with luxury amenities such as heated/cooled seats, a panoramic sunroof, and bespoke interior finishes.

Financing Options for the 2025 Land Cruiser

Toyota Financial Services provides competitive financing rates, often as low as 2.9% APR for qualified buyers. Loan terms typically range from 36 to 72 months, allowing flexibility in monthly payments. Leasing is another popular option, with monthly payments starting at $900 for a 36-month term and 10,000 miles annually. Trade-in incentives and loyalty discounts can further reduce costs for existing Toyota owners.

Additional Ownership Costs

Beyond the purchase price, Land Cruiser owners should budget for insurance, which averages $1,800 annually. Fuel costs can be significant due to the SUV's large engine, with an estimated annual expense of $3,000 for 15,000 miles. Maintenance packages from Toyota, priced at $1,200 for three years, help mitigate unexpected repair costs.

Insurance and Fuel Economy

The Land Cruiser's insurance premiums are higher than average due to its luxury status and repair costs. Fuel economy is approximately 17 MPG combined, making it less efficient than smaller SUVs but competitive within its class.
